Keyless Entry System
The keyless entry system on your Fiat 500 allows you to unlock the doors with the press of a button, and without having to reach in your pockets. This is ideal for those with busy hands or kids. It helps prevent them from locking the vehicle. It also lets you start the car with the touch of a button, a feature that is particularly useful during hot weather or when you're carrying a lot of shopping bags.
The system transmits a digital identification number through radio waves that the vehicle can recognize. It does this within the course of a small distance, usually within just a few meters of the vehicle. This allows features such as unlocking the doors automatically as you are near a vehicle, or starting the car with just a single button to be possible.

Transponder Key
The majority of modern car keys include an embedded microchip inside the key fob that communicates with the immobiliser system within your vehicle. The chip is programmed to contain a unique code that is only transmitted to the vehicle when the key is inserted in the ignition. The vehicle will only start its engine if it recognises the code as valid.
This technology was developed to combat car theft by employing the hot-wiring method which used high-voltage power in order to start the car without the need for a key. The car key's transponder, a portmanteau of responder and transmitter, has a wire coil wrapped around it. The coil is attached to the ignition barrel. When the key is inserted, it transmits a pulse of electromagnetic energy to the transponder that emits a specific code. The computer onboard of the car checks the code and, if it matches the code, will start the engine.
While the transponder car key is a great way to guard against car theft, it's not completely secure. If you lose your key, or if it's damaged, you'll need to replace it with an automotive locksmith. A locksmith in the auto industry can cut a replacement key that matches the exact shape of the original one, so it can be inserted into locks and mechanically lock and unlock your vehicle. Locksmiths also have the tools needed to program the transponder chip of a new model into your Fiat key fob, and to ensure that it's compatible with the immobiliser system of your car.

Keyless Start
Fiat 500 keyless start systems are designed to help deter theft. Without the physical key and the mechanical steering column lock, thieves will have difficulty getting into your vehicle to take it away. However, they are not safe. Researchers have demonstrated that, with the right equipment and the key fob's signal you can open or start your car. This type of theft, though more difficult than securing a car window it has been successfully carried out by tech-savvy criminals. The battery is the first thing you should verify for if your FIAT keyfob isn't working. These small "watch" batteries are 3.3 Volt lithium, CR2032s and you can find them nearly everywhere for less than $3. These are the most common cause of a non-working key fob.
